The Library does not rent textbooks, but we do have some textbooks that may be borrowed and some that may be used here in the Library.  If you wish to rent a textbook, you will need to contact the Campus Bookstore at 215-646-7300 ext. 21468.

The Library does not have copies of every textbook for every class, but we do have some copies that have been placed on Reserve by instructors.  These textbooks are located at the Circulation Desk in the Library lobby and they may only be used in the Library.  They cannot be borrowed and taken out of the Library. 

There are a few textbooks that can be borrowed. To check whether the Library has the book you need, go to KeissCat, the Library's online catalog, (under the pull-down menu Library Catalogs) on the Library's homepage.  Type in the exact title of the book you need and change the pull-down menu to Title.   If the book is available, you will see a screen with all of the information about the book, including its call number and its location in the Library.  These books can be borrowed for three weeks.  You may renew the borrowing period two times if no on else requests the book while you have it.
